Description |
Quilted silk dressing gown owned by Eliza Brown Baily. The brown silk gown is quilted in a floral pattern and has three pockets. The pockets are made of leather and trimmed in fur. Sleeves are full and there is a button detail at the end of the sleeves. There is a drawstring at the waist with fur pom-poms. Eliza's name is sewn onto the back of the dressing gown in yellow thread and reads: "Mrs. J.C. Baily, Fortress Monroe, VA" Quilted dressing gowns like this were made in Japan for American export. |
